Best Coshocton County Public Charter Schools (2026)

For the 2026 school year, there is 1 public charter school serving 53 students in Coshocton County, OH.
The top-ranked public charter school in Coshocton County, OH is Coshocton Opportunity School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Coshocton County, OH public charter school have an average math proficiency score of 10% (versus the Ohio public charter school average of 24%), and reading proficiency score of 20% (versus the 37% statewide average). Charter schools in Coshocton County have an average ranking of 1/10, which is in the bottom 50% of Ohio public charter schools.
Minority enrollment is 9%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is less than the Ohio public charter school average of 65% (majority Black).
